News item is a type of the text that has the main function or communicative purpose to inform
readers of listeners or viewer about events of the day that are considered newsworthy or
important. The generic structure of news item has elements as follows.

Headline/ title: the main point to report in reduced clause.

Summary of event: the summary of main event that is to be reported.

Background of event: the explanation about what had happened (who, what, when, where).

Source: someones about the event.

B) Example 2, News Item Text: Quake victims play waiting game

Nethy Dharma Somba

The Jakarta Post/ Manokwari, West Papua

Thousand of quake survivors cramped makeshift shelters in Manokwari on Monday as aftershocks


continued to rock the region a day after two powerful earthquake flattened hundreds of buildings
and killed four people.

For the time being, there are 14,000 refugees, West Papua Governor Abraham
Atururi said, adding that 17 camps had been set up for displaced in the provincial capital of
Manokwari.

The National Disaster Mitigation Body said the quake had killed two people, injured
35 other and damaged hundreds of buildings.

As said started to arrive Monday, hundreds of aftershocks continued to rattle the


coastal city which had been hit by 7,6 and 7,5 magnitude quakes early Sunday, cutting power and
prompting a brief tsunami warning.

Atururi said a 10 year old girl had been killed in the quakes.

Hundreds of government and private buildings were also damaged, as well as seven
bridges, two of which collapsed, he said.

Jayapuras Meteorology and Geophysics Agency (BMG) office said West Papua had
been hit by 842 aftershocks over a period of 29 hours after the first quake, including 54 strong
after shocks all rated at more than 5 on the Richter scale.

It keeps on shaking, Papua BMG spokesman, Mujahidin said.

Evacuees erected tents along the road near their homes despite the nearby refugee
centers.

We will stay in the tents until the government issues an official statement stating the
condition is safe, La Atin, 45, an evacuee from Wirsi village, told The Jakarta Post.

Atin and 10 other families from Wirsi said they preferred to continue living in tents
erected along the road because they feared more aftershocks and tsunami would strike.
During the earthquake in 1996, our home were swept away by tidal waves. The water
at one point rose, prompting us to seek shelter on higher ground, said Atin, whose house is
located near a beach.

He left for shelter with his family and their belongings, including mattresses, mats,
stove and rice.

We have not received relief aid from the government but we can still eat because we
brought rice from home, said Ria, Atin s wife.

Following Mondays aftershocks that rocked Manokwari city, Sorong city, and Sorong
regency. President Susilo Bambang Yudhoyono dispatched to the region four ministers armed with
cash aid and supplies. The ministers are Social Minister, Bachtiar Chamsyah, Health Minister, Siti
Fadilah Supari, Public Works Minister, Djoko Kirmanto, and Transportation Minister, Jusman Syafii
Djamal to West Papua.

The ministers brought with them Rp 1 billion (US$93,023) in cash, 600 tons of rice,
medical supplies, an ambulance and a car to carry refugees to shelters.

Bacthiar called on victims who had not received aid to remain patient, adding there
was an insufficient number of relief works in the region.

He said he would dispatch a team to West Papua to survey and rebuild damaged
homes. Buildings collapsed by the quakes, including the three story Mutiara hotel, were closed off
with police tape and guarded by soldiers.

(Source: The Jakarta Post, January 6, 2009)

4) Example 4, news item text: Gold tumbles to more than 2 month low as risk grows

Gold dropped to its lowest in more than two months as investor risk
appetite increased, reducing the metals appeal as a heaven.

Bullion has tumbled 5,2 percent in three days on growing optimism that the world
financial crisis maybe easing. Asian stocks advanced for a fourth day after Federal Reserve
Chairman, Ben S. Bernance, said policy responses were helping to unfreeze credit markets. The
metal has dropped 6,5 percent in the past month as the benchmark MSCI Asia Pacific Index surged
21 percent.

The gold price came off from US$920, $930 because the equity market has been
performing better, said Bob Takai, general manager of financial services at Sumitomo Corp. in
Tokyo.

Gold for immediate delivery fell for a third day, sliding as much as 2,1 percent to
$874,98 an ounce, the lowest since January 23, before trading at $878,57 an ounce at 2:09 pm in
Singapore. June delivery gold dipped 1,9 percent to $880.20 an ounce on the comex division of
the New York Mercantile Exchange.

We may be through the worst, but we are not yet out of the woods, Takai said in a
Bloomberg Television Interview, Monday. I recommend people holding gold positions at the
moment to sell. Keep it just in case something happens.

Investment in the SPDR Gold Trust, the biggest exchange traded fund backed by
billion, declined for the first time since March, 23. The fund held 1,127.37 tons of gold as of April
3m down from 1,127.44 tons on April 2, a level which had been unchanged for four days. Still, gold
may rebound this week on concern that consumer prices may increase. Spurring demand for the
precious metal as a hedge against inflation.

Twelve of 17 traders, investors, and analysts, or 71 percent surveyed by Bloomberg


News, said gold would climb. Four people or 24 percent forecast lower prices and one was
neutral.

Price of goods imported into the US Probably rose 0.9 percent in March, the first
increase since July, according to the median estimate of 18 economists surveyed by Bloomberg
News. The Labor Department report is set for release April 9.
You never know if this financial crisis is going to be over, and you ever know if the
equity rise is going to continue, so you need to buy the insurance, said Takai.

Hedge fund managers and other large speculators increased their net long position in
New York gold futures in the week ended March 31 by 1 percent, according to US Commodity
Futures Trading Commission data.

(Source: The Jakarta Post, April 7, 2009)
